zoukankan      html  css  js  c++  java
  • [Java] 03 String获取文件后缀名,判断文件是否合法

    package test.string;
    
    import java.util.Arrays;
    import java.util.List;
    
    public class GetFileType {
        private static List<String> accTypes = Arrays.asList("jpg","bmp","gif","doc","docx","rar");
        public static void main(String[] args){
            for(String arg:args){
                String type = getFileType(arg);
                if(accTypes.contains(type)){
                    System.out.println(arg+"后缀合法");
                }else{
                    System.out.println(arg+"后缀不合法");
                }
            }
        }
        /**
         * 获取文件后缀名
         * @param filename
         * @return
         */
        public static String getFileType(String filename){
            int pos = filename.lastIndexOf(".");
            if(pos == -1){
                return null;
            }
            return filename.substring(pos+1);
        }
    }
  • 相关阅读:
    slenium截屏
    效率提升
    R语言网页爬虫
    高性能计算
    数据操作
    数据库操作
    面向对象编程
    元编程
    R 的内部机制
    数据处理
  • 原文地址:https://www.cnblogs.com/frost-yen/p/5382623.html
Copyright © 2011-2022 走看看